Blog

How to secure WordPress website

Website security is critical. A hacked site can lead to data loss, SEO drop, and downtime. Follow these proven steps to secure your WordPress site properly.

LogicWave It Solutions

Published on 23 Mar 20265 min read

1. Keep WordPress Updated

Keeping your WordPress core, themes, and plugins updated is the most important step in securing your website. Outdated files often contain vulnerabilities that hackers can exploit. Always update regularly and remove any unused plugins or themes to reduce risk.

2. Use Strong Login Credentials

Weak usernames and passwords make it easy for attackers to gain access. Avoid using “admin” as your username and always create strong passwords with a mix of letters, numbers, and symbols. Enabling two-factor authentication (2FA) adds an extra layer of protection.

3. Install a Security Plugin

Security plugins provide firewall protection, malware scanning, and login security. They help detect threats early and block malicious activity before it affects your website. Choose a reliable plugin and keep it updated for maximum protection.

4. Limit Login Attempts

Hackers often use brute-force attacks to guess passwords. Limiting login attempts blocks users after several failed tries, reducing the chances of unauthorized access. You can also add CAPTCHA to further secure your login page.

5. Use SSL (HTTPS)

SSL certificates encrypt data between your website and visitors, protecting sensitive information like login details and payment data. Always use HTTPS and ensure there are no mixed content issues on your site.

6. Take Regular Backups

Backups are essential in case your website gets hacked or crashes. Schedule automatic backups and store them on secure cloud platforms. This ensures you can quickly restore your site without losing data.

7. Secure Important Files

Files like wp-config.php and .htaccess contain critical configuration data. Restrict access to these files and disable directory browsing to prevent unauthorized users from viewing sensitive information.

8. Avoid Nulled Themes & Plugins

Nulled or pirated themes and plugins often contain hidden malware or backdoors. Always download themes and plugins from trusted sources to keep your website safe and secure.

9. Change Default Login URL

The default WordPress login URL is easy for attackers to find. Changing it to a custom URL reduces the chances of automated attacks and adds an extra layer of security.

10. Manage User Roles Properly

Only give admin access to trusted users. Remove inactive accounts and assign roles carefully to minimize security risks. Limiting access helps protect your website from internal threats.

11. Disable File Editing

WordPress allows file editing from the dashboard, which can be risky. Disabling this feature prevents attackers from injecting malicious code directly into your theme or plugin files.

12. Scan Website Regularly

Regular security scans help detect malware and vulnerabilities early. Use security tools to monitor your site and fix issues before they become serious problems.

13. Use Secure Hosting

Your hosting provider plays a big role in website security. Choose a reliable hosting service that offers built-in security features like firewalls, malware scanning, and regular updates.

14. Set Proper File Permissions

Incorrect file permissions can expose your website to attacks. Set proper permissions (typically 644 for files and 755 for folders) to protect your website from unauthorized access.

15. Enable Activity Logs

Activity logs help you track user actions on your website. Monitoring logs allows you to quickly identify suspicious behavior and take action before any damage occurs.

Recent Posts

How to increase WooCommerce sales

LogicWave It Solutions • March 23, 2026

How to secure WordPress website

LogicWave It Solutions • March 23, 2026

Simple Ways to Fix WordPress Not Sending Emails

LogicWave It Solutions • March 18, 2026